Section Title:
Microbial Ecology Methods
Section Info:
This course will briefly discuss experimental design, and will provide experience in techniques for sampling aquatic microorganisms. Students will also be introduced to modern molecular biology techniques for characterizing environmental microbial populations and bioinformatics tools to aid in the interpretation of molecular biology data. Student preparation: Prior experience in microbiology, ecology, and biochemistry is helpful, however, introductory lectures will review the necessary principles of microbiology and molecular biology, providing a minimum background for the remainder of the course. This course is limited to graduate students.
